BEd Program Details
The B.Ed. The programme offered by Dr. B.R. Ambedkar Open University (BRAOU) is an innovative programme utilizing self-instructional material and information technology along with interactive personal contact programmes.
It aims at developing understanding and competencies required by practicing teachers for the effective teaching-learning process at the secondary stage.

The Programme is essentially a judicious mix of theoretical and practical courses to develop the practicing teacher’s knowledge, skills, understanding, and attitudes. Illustrations and cases of relevant situations and need-based activities comprise the core of each course of the programme.
B.Ed Program Objectives
The programme aims to enable practicing teachers to achieve the following objectives:
- To strengthen the professional competencies of in-service teachers.
- To develop an understanding of the various methods and approaches to organizing learning experiences for secondary school students.
- To understand the nature of the learning process and develop the skills required in selecting and organizing learning experiences.
- To develop skills involved in dealing with the academic and personal problems of learners.
- To develop skills in the selection, development, and usage of evaluation tools and to develop an understanding of the various techniques of evaluation in the classroom.
- To develop an understanding of various aspects of school management in organizing various instructional and co-curricular activities.
Distance B.Ed Programme Fee
The Tuition fee is Rs. 40,000/- (Rupees Forty Thousand only) for the entire programme of two years. The total Tuition fee has to be paid at the time of admission in a single payment through ONLINE. Examination Fee has to be paid as per the norms of the University.
Duration of BEd Program:
- Minimum period to complete the programme is 2 Academic years.
- Maximum period to complete the programme is 4 Academic years.
- If any student unable to complete the programme with in Maximum period readmission will be given as per the University rules.
The medium of Instruction: The medium of instruction is Telugu. A student should write the answers in Year-end- Examination, Assignments, and Records, Teaching Practice and Practical Lesson Records only in Telugu.

BRAOU B.Ed Entrance Test Eligibility Criteria:
Candidate satisfying the following requirements shall be eligible to appear for the entrance test.
- The candidate should be an Indian citizen.
- Candidates should have passed a Bachelor’s Degree i.e., B.A. / B.Sc. / B.Sc. (Home Science) / B.Com./ B.C.A. / B.B.M. or should have appeared for the final year examination in any of these courses at the time of applying for the B.Ed. Entrance Test.
- Those appearing in the qualifying examination (Bachelor or a higher degree) can also apply. But they will be required to submit the proof of having passed the qualifying examination at the time of admission.
- Otherwise, they are not allowed for admission counseling and their provisional admission will stand canceled.
- The candidate must also fulfill the following conditions along with the above
- (A) Teachers presently working (In-service) and have completed at least two years of experience as on 01-07-2021 on temporary/permanent basis in a primary, secondary / higher / senior secondary school recognized by the central or a state government or a union territory.
- (B) Candidate should have completed 21 years as on 01-07-2021. No upper age limit.

B.Ed entrance test syllabus
The Question paper of the Entrance will have 3 parts for 100 marks. The details are given below.
- Part-A General English Comprehension – 25 Marks
- Part-B Proficiency in Telugu – 25 Marks
- Part-C General Mental Ability – 50 Marks
B.Ed Entrance Test Exam Pattern
- The entrance test will be held on 06-06-2023.
- Candidates are expected in the examination hall by Half an hour before the examination.
- The entrance test will be for 100 Marks with 100 objective types (Multiple Choice) questions and is of 2 hours duration.
- The syllabus and the model questions are furnished separately in this booklet.
The medium of Entrance Test: The question paper, except the General English section, will be in Telugu. Note: The Qualifying mark in the B.Ed. Entrance Test for all candidates, except SC / ST, is 35. For the candidates belonging to SC / ST communities ranking will be extended below the qualifying mark.
Ranking: Candidates will be ranked in the order of merit in the B.Ed. entrance test. In case of candidates getting equal marks, Part-C marks will be taken into account to decide relative ranking. In the case of a tie, the marks obtained in Part-B and then Part-A will be taken into account to decide relative ranking.
In the case of candidates getting equal marks in each of the parts of the test paper, age shall be taken into consideration for relative ranking among the bracketed candidates, and the older candidates shall be given priority. Eligibility Criteria for the choice of subject methodology in B.Ed:
i. Mathematics: B.A. / B.Sc. with Mathematics as one of the group subjects and B.C.A. candidates with Mathematics at Intermediate level in optional Mathematics stream are also eligible.
ii. Physical Sciences: Candidates with B.Sc. who have studied Physics and Chemistry OR Allied Material Sciences under Part-II group subjects. B.C.A. candidates with Physical Sciences (Physics & Chemistry) at Intermediate level as group subjects are also eligible.
iii. Biological Sciences: Candidates with B.Sc. / B.Sc. (Home Science) who have studied Botany and Zoology OR Allied Life Sciences under Part-II group subjects and B.C.A. candidates with Biological Sciences at Intermediate level with optional Biological Sciences are also eligible.
iv. Social Studies: All candidates with B.A. / B.Com./B.O.L. students with Social Studies background at Intermediate level as group subjects are eligible.
Note: The percentage of a number of candidates to be admitted in each methodology (subject) in the University shall be as follows: (a) Mathematics: 30% (b) Physical Sciences: 15% (c) Biological Sciences: 25% (d) Social Studies: 30%
